Copyright

Copyright is a set of exclusive rights available

for a limited time to protect the particular form,

way or manner in which an idea or information

is expressed. Broad classifications are: Literary

Works, Artistic Works, Cinematographic Works

and Record Works.

Related/ Neighboring Rights

Related Rights protect the legal interests of

persons and legal entities

(Performers/Broadcasters etc.) who contribute to

making works available to the public through their

investment /skills.

International Treaties/Conventions on Copyright

• Berne Convention, 1886 (Signatory)

• Universal Copyright Convention, 1952 (Signatory)

• TRIPS Agreement, 1994 (Signatory)

• Rome Convention, 1961

• WCT, 1996

Internet Treaties

• WPPT, 1996

British Copyright Act, 1911.

Replaced by the Copyright Ordinance, 1962.

Amended in the year 2000 in compliance with TRIPS

Agreement.

The copyright rules of, 1967 as amended in 2002.

The Copyright Board (Procedure) Regulations 1981.

The International Copyright Order, 1968.

The Copyright Office, at Karachi in 1963.

Registration in 1967.

Branch office in 1986 at Lahore.

Copyright Legislations in Pakistan

Works in which Copyright subsists

Part-I: Literary works (Books, Magazines, Journals, Lectures,

Sermons, Dramas, Novels, etc. including Computer Software and Compilation of Data).

Part-II: Artistic works

(Paintings, Photographs, Maps, Charts, Calligraphies, Sculptures, Architectural Works, Drawings, Label

Designs, Logos, Monograms etc). Part-III: Cinematographic works

(Motion Pictures, Video Cassettes, VCD’s, DVD’s etc.).

Part-IV: Records Works

(Audio Cassettes and CD’s).

Duration (Term) of Copyright

For Literary, Dramatic, Musical and Artistic

works, life time of the Author plus 50 years

next after his death

For posthumous works: 50 years after first

publication

For Cinematographic, Record Works: 50

years after first publication

Protection of Related Rights

Performers’ Rights (e.g. actors, singers, musicians, choreographers,

entertainers etc.) Term of protection: 50 years Rights of Producers of Phonograms (sound

recordings) Term of protection: 50 years Broadcasters’ Rights Term of protection: 25 yearsRental Rights of Computer Programs and

Cinematographic Works

Assignment/Transfer of Copyright

The owner may Assign/Transfer/Sell these rights to any

person

wholly or partially

generally or subject to limitations

for the whole term or any part

Assignment should be in writing

By assignment in writing for 10 years only, reverting

back to the author/owner of copyright if not published

within a period of three years.

Copyright Board

Board acts as an “Appellate Authority” against any order of the Registrar

Consisting of a Chairman and three to five members & constituted for three years.

Representing various stakeholders of copyright. 3

rectification/expunction of entries from register,

regulations of performing rights societies and

compulsory licensing etc

Appeal against its orders lies to High Court/Supreme Court.

International Copyright National Treatment to foreign copyright work.

Infringement

Infringement of Copyright

Copies, issues copies, rents out, imports or exports or

performs the work without consent or license of the owner. When Copyright not Infringed (Exceptions) A fair dealing for

Research or private study;Criticism or review,Reporting current events

Judicial proceeding Reproduction or adaptation by teachers or pupil for

instruction in education etc. etc.

Remedies

Border Measures Prohibition on Importation and Exportation by Customs

Authorities/Registrar. Civil Remedies

Jurisdiction of District Court Injunctions, decrees of damages and accounts May also seize, destroy or deliver the infringed

material to the owner Criminal Remedies

Cognizable and Non- bailable offences. Criminal Courts empowered to award monetary

compensations also.

Penalties and Cognizance

Penalties Imprisonment three years Fine Rs. one lac /two lacs Or both

Cognizance Agencies District Police FIA Pakistan Customs Private Detection Agencies

Registration of Copyright

03 copies of application Form-II

Rs.500/- registration fee in the form of a Demand Draft/Pay-Order in the name of Director General IPO-Pakistan.

A- Literary work 2 copies of literary work published or un-published.

NOC for assignment of copyright from the owner of the work if any.

Vakalatnama/Power of Attorney if applying through attorney

B-Record & Cinematographic Work 2 copies of work in the form of VCD/DVD/Audio/Video Cassette etc.

NOC for assignment of copyright from the contributors (performers/singer/ lyric writer/musician etc.) of the work.

Vakalatnama/Power of Attorney if applying through attorney

Page 21: Slide 1 - IPO Pakistan - Intellectual Property Organisation of

21

Registration of Copyright

C. Artistic Work 03 copies of Artistic Work. NOC/ Affidavit for transfer of copyright from Artist/creator

who created the work. Undertaking/ Affidavit for original creativity of the work by

the applicant. The applicant is required to advertise artistic work in any

Urdu or English language daily newspaper, where the applicant resides or carries on business within 30 days of filing of application and send two copies thereof to the Registrar of Copyrights.

Vakalatnama/Power of Attorney if applying through attorney

Registration of Copyright

1. Filing of application

2. Examination

3. Opposition, if any

4. Issuance of Certificate by Registrar

(Registration)

Challenges for copyright system

The emergence of e-technologies arises new issues in the field of copyright and related rights

The copyright contents in digital form can be stored in very compressed and can be transferred very easily with the same quality.

Basic pillars of copyright law as given under are needed to match technological issues.

Legislation;

Secure networks;

Enforcement measures;

Identification and technological protection measures;

Rights management system

Page 26: Slide 1 - IPO Pakistan - Intellectual Property Organisation of

Challenges for copyright system

Pakistan has amended its copyright law in 2000 in light of

TRIPS agreement and provide protection to computer

programmes and compilation of data.

The WCT and WPPT also called the “Internet Treaties”,

provide a good legislative frame work for copyright in

digital environment

To address the emerging issues of technology in copyright

legislation it requires in dep understanding of these issues

by the stakeholders.
